UPS (NYSE:UPS) has completed its latest regional ground packagesortation and distribution hub, further facilitating commercebetween the Pacific Northwest and the world. The new facility alsosignificantly increases the UPS delivery fleet serving the greaterSeattle-Tacoma area, the largest metropolitan area in thenorthwestern United States. Adding 777,000 square feet of newautomation-driven processing capacity to UPS’s global network, thehub has created more than 800 full- and part-time jobs.

Covering an area the size of more than 13 football fields, thenew Tacoma regional hub is powered by highly-automated technologythat rapidly moves packages through the scanning and sortingprocess, capturing data to increase delivery accuracy and addingflexibility to respond to customer needs. High speed UPS SmartLabel® applicators place labels on packages at a rate of three persecond, providing UPS employees instructions for proper routing andloading into waiting trailers headed to destinations across thecountry, or into package delivery vehicles bound for Tacoma-areabusinesses and residents.
Innovative technology provides increased speed, efficiency andflexibility to move packages within UPS facilities as well asthroughout the company’s smart global logistics network. AcrossNorth America, the company is implementing additional smallautonomous guided tow tractors or “tugs” to move large orirregularly-shaped packages within its hubs that are not able to bemoved on conveyor systems due to size, shape or weight. UPS’sproprietary Network Planning Tools (NPT) integrate UPS’s air andground operations across the U.S. and around the globe. NPT enablesUPS to reduce time-in-transit while efficiently managing spikes inshipping volume and severe weather.
UPS also recently opened a new package delivery facility inHillsboro, Ore. to serve the rapidly growing business andresidential demand in the surrounding Portland area. Both newpackage processing operations are part of UPS’s enterprise-widetransformation initiatives that will add more than 5.5uare feet of new automated sortation globally ahead of the 2020holiday season.
Founded in Seattle in 1907, UPS employs more than 12,200people across Washington and Oregon in package delivery operations,air operations, ground freight, healthcare and life scienceslogistics, freight forwarding and contract logistics services.Permanent UPS jobs – including part-time jobs -- come with greatpay and benefits, including healthcare and retirement benefits.
